Costs for treadmills sale

Treadmills are an excellent option for walkers or runners who don't want to spend money on gym fees or worry about the weather outside. However, there are several important factors to consider when buying a treadmill. Included in this are your goals for fitness as well as your budget, and the space you have available. Consider features that will make your workouts fun and challenging. You can, for example opt for a machine that has a touchscreen with virtual classes or a simpler machine that offers only basic metrics and programming.

Before purchasing a treadmill, it's important to know what you intend to use it for. If you're only going to use it for light jogging and walking, a less expensive treadmill could be adequate. However, if you're going to be running for long distances or compete in a competitive manner, then a more costly model is worth the extra investment.

The running deck is an important aspect to think about. You should generally look for an exercise machine that is at least 20 inches wide and 55 inches long to accommodate your stride comfortably. You should also consider if you'd like to add an incline feature to your treadmill, as this can help you burn more calories and improve the difficulty of your exercises.

You should also check out the console's special features. Some of these features might be available, but some might be worth the extra cost. You might require Bluetooth connectivity or tablet holders to use your phone while exercising. Other features, such as water bottle holders and fans, are more functional.

Basic treadmills will come with some standard features, like forward or reverse striding and hand grips that are stationary and detect your pulse. It also has various programs built-in, including manual and automated options. You can alter the speed by pressing a button, or changing the tilt.

A more advanced treadmill will have a touchscreen display which can be seen in any lighting or condition. It will also be able to accommodate more programs and connect to your smartphone.
